Knowing what to expect and how to navigate the facility can help ease anxiety and ensure you receive timely care. Located in Little Rock, Arkansas, the UAMS Medical Center is a leading academic hospital equipped to handle a wide range of emergencies 24/7. Upon arrival, patients are greeted by a triage nurse who assesses the severity of their condition, which determines the order of care. A: The UAMS Medical Center Emergency Room is located at 4301 W Markham St, Little Rock, AR 72205.Q: What should I bring to the emergency room? A: It's best to bring personal identification, insurance information, and a list of current medications and health conditions.Q: How is patient priority determined in the ER? A: Patients are seen based on the severity of their condition using a triage system, not on a first-come, first-served basis.Q: Can family or friends accompany me in the ER?
